European bank lifeboat plans lift markets

clock

The FTSE 100 made up some of the ground lost in recent days, gaining over 100 points in early trading, amid talk in Europe of plans to recapitalise the banking system.

The blue chip index jumped to 5,072 points initially, before settling at 5,000.23 points by 8:54am, with miners and banks taking the index up 1.1%. The rally in the UK followed gains in the US overnight where investors sent the S&P 500 up 2.3%, or 24.7 points, to 1,123.95. The Dow also finished higher, up 1.4% or 153 points to 10,808, as markets made a stand following a sharp sell-off in the last few days.
